Carlos Alcaraz, Jannik Sinner and Novak Djokovic are all on the roster for the Mutua Madrid Open, the fourth ATP Masters 1000 event of the season.

The clay-court event will take place from April 22 to May 3 and will feature all the top 10 players in the PIF ATP rankings. Caspar Ruud is the defending ATP Masters 1000 champion, having won the biggest trophy of his career at the 2025 event.

World No. 1 Alcaraz is a two-time winner on home soil in Madrid, while Sinner is a two-time Masters 1000 finalist. Djokovic has won the title three times, last lifting the trophy in 2019.

Former champions Alexander Zverev and Andrei Rublev were also on hand. Former Next Generation ATP Finals champions Learner Tien and Joao Fonseca will also compete.
